NOVELTY - Preparation of graphene-modified glass fiber involves mixing water and glass fiber, adding alkaline solution, adjusting pH to 8-9, uniformly dispersing, filtering glass fiber, drying, adding obtained pretreated glass fiber to an active agent-containing graphene dispersion having pH of 6-7, and filtering obtained graphene-modified glass fiber dispersion. USE - Preparation of graphene-modified glass fiber used for preparing sulfate-resistant graphene concrete composite material (all claimed). ADVANTAGE - The method enables preparation of graphene-modified glass fiber with high strength and flexibility, and large surface area. The graphene-modified glass fiber provides sulfate-resistant graphene concrete composite material with high toughness. DETAILED DESCRIPTION - INDEPENDENT CLAIMS are included for the following: (1) sulfate-resistant graphene concrete composite material, which comprises 120-280 kg/m3 cement, 40-50 kg/m3 fly ash, 40-80 kg/m3 fumed silica, 450-900 kg/m3 coarse aggregate, 60-130 kg/m3 sand, 15-60 kg/m3 nano-silica, 25-60 kg/m3 graphene-modified glass fiber, 0.5-8 kg/m3 water reducing agent and 100-180 kg/m3 water; and (2) preparation of sulfate-resistant graphene concrete composite material.
